The receiving frame circuit board is designed to route the drive's -HOST SLV/ACT signal

(drive activity) to the activity indicator light on the front panel of the DE90i-A receiving

frame. A connection to J3 Pin 3 (on the carrier board) should only be made if the drive

does not support this -HOST SLV/ACT signal on Pin 39 of the interface connector (check

the documentation that accompanied the drive and controller). If this J3 Pin 3 connection

is made, move jumper JP39 on the receiving frame from the "A" to the "B" position.

Three (3) Drive Type Jumpers, W1, W2, and W3 are available to control the signal levels at

J3, Pins 1 & 2.

Table 2 shows the signal levels on J3 Pin 1 and Pin 2 for different W1, W2, and W3 jumper

settings. Connections to J3 Pin 1 should be made with signals from the drive that refer to Master,

while connections to J3 Pin 2 should be made with signals from the drive that refer to Slave.
